EOC Chairperson shares her vision with ‘Hong Kong Lawyer’

EOC Chairperson Ms Linda LAM Mei-sau shared her vision and views on the development of equal opportunities in Hong Kong in the October 2024 issue of Hong Kong Lawyer, the official journal of the Law Society of Hong Kong. 

In the wide-ranging interview, Ms Lam highlighted the changes in the anti-discrimination legal framework over the years while underlining the EOC’s impact at the individual, organisational, and macro levels in promoting equal opportunities in Hong Kong. In addition to reviewing past achievements and milestones, she also commented on the growing prominence that artificial intelligence and automated systems will have on the equality landscape.

“We are still at the early stages of formulating responses to the challenge new technology poses, and it will require ongoing dialogue and collaborations across sectors to implement effective measures. We believe that the Government could play a leading role in this regard by developing inclusive digital public services that are useable by people with different abilities, as such practices could encourage the private sector to follow suit. In the long run, it may be necessary to enact new laws to require private digital service providers to offer human alternatives and ensure that their services are free of biases,” she said.
